Elite Builders, B General Building Contractor in Sunnyvale, CA
Elite Builders operating as a corporation hol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#1036996), valid through Mar 31, 2028. First issued in 2018,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 8 years. It carries 2 CSLB classifications: B General Building Contractor and C-15 Flooring and Floor Covering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with American Contractors Indemnity Company and a previously-filed workers' compensation policy with State Compensation Insurance Fund that is no longer active. The business is based in Sunnyvale, in Santa Clara County, California.
